JOB SUMMARY
This role is responsible for planning, managing, and delivering risk-based internal audits across the Group. The role ensures the adequacy and effectiveness of governance, risk management, and internal controls, while providing independent and practical assurance to senior management and the Audit Committee.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
1. Audit Planning & Execution
- Develop and execute the Group Internal Audit Plan using a risk-based approach.
- Lead end-to-end audit engagements, including planning, fieldwork, reporting, and follow-up.
- Operating under the policies established by the Audit Committee, Board of Directors, Guidelines and regulations under the Ministry of Economics and Finance, administered by the Insurance Regulator of Cambodia, and any other directives issued from time to time.
- Identify control gaps, process inefficiencies, and emerging risks across entities and functions.
- Perform thematic, cross-functional, and special audits as requested by management or the Audit Committee.
- Developing an annual audit plan using an appropriate risk-based methodology, including any risks or control concerns identified by management, and submitting that plan to the Audit Committee for review and approval.
2. Risk, Governance & Control Assurance
- Implementing the annual audit plan, as approved, including, and as appropriate, any special tasks or projects requested by the audit committee.
- Evaluate the effectiveness of internal controls, risk management, and governance processes.
- Assess compliance with internal policies, laws, regulations, and contractual obligations.
- Provide assurance over key business processes, including finance, operations, IT, compliance, underwriting, claims, and distribution (adjust per industry).
- Support enterprise risk management by validating risk assessments and control design.
3. Stakeholder Management & Reporting
- Communicate audit findings clearly to management, including root causes and practical recommendations to senior management and the Audit Committee.
- Prepare high-quality audit reports for senior management and the Audit Committee.
- Track and follow up on management action plans and remediation status.
- Build constructive working relationships while maintaining independence.
- Keep the audit committee informed of emerging trends and successful practices in internal auditing.
- Assist in the investigation of significant suspected fraudulent activities within the organization and notify Management and the audit committee of the results.
4. Team Leadership & Development
- Lead, coach, and review the work of internal auditors.
- Allocate resources effectively across Group audits.
- Support capability building, audit quality, and continuous improvement within the IA function.
- Review working papers to ensure audit quality and consistency.
5. Advisory & Special Projects
- Provide advisory support on new initiatives, system implementations, and process changes.
- Participate in investigations, fraud reviews, or regulatory reviews as required.
- Act as a trusted advisor on control design without owning the controls.
6. Leadership and Management
- Establish and uphold high standards of performance and ethics for the team in line with Forte Group’s to ensure effectiveness, efficiency, and social responsibilities are met.
- Lead and motivate subordinates to advance employee engagement and develop a high-performing team.
- Lead and develop the teams to ensure their professional growth and sustainable organizational succession.
